mirror of
https://github.com/Syngnat/GoNavi.git
synced 2026-06-01 02:39:36 +08:00
- 收敛 App 与 AI Service 的内部生命周期方法,避免被 Wails 误导出到前端 - 将启动初始化改为包级生命周期接线,保持主程序启动流程不变 - 隐藏内部清理方法,移除生成绑定中的无效 context/time 类型声明 - 同步更新 frontend/wailsjs 绑定文件,清理 Service 与 App 的错误导出 - 调整相关测试调用,确保内部方法重命名后行为一致
84 lines
2.4 KiB
JavaScript
Executable File
84 lines
2.4 KiB
JavaScript
Executable File
// @ts-check
|
|
// Cynhyrchwyd y ffeil hon yn awtomatig. PEIDIWCH Â MODIWL
|
|
// This file is automatically generated. DO NOT EDIT
|
|
|
|
export function AIChatCancel(arg1) {
|
|
return window['go']['aiservice']['Service']['AIChatCancel'](arg1);
|
|
}
|
|
|
|
export function AIChatSend(arg1, arg2) {
|
|
return window['go']['aiservice']['Service']['AIChatSend'](arg1, arg2);
|
|
}
|
|
|
|
export function AIChatStream(arg1, arg2, arg3) {
|
|
return window['go']['aiservice']['Service']['AIChatStream'](arg1, arg2, arg3);
|
|
}
|
|
|
|
export function AICheckSQL(arg1) {
|
|
return window['go']['aiservice']['Service']['AICheckSQL'](arg1);
|
|
}
|
|
|
|
export function AIDeleteProvider(arg1) {
|
|
return window['go']['aiservice']['Service']['AIDeleteProvider'](arg1);
|
|
}
|
|
|
|
export function AIDeleteSession(arg1) {
|
|
return window['go']['aiservice']['Service']['AIDeleteSession'](arg1);
|
|
}
|
|
|
|
export function AIGetActiveProvider() {
|
|
return window['go']['aiservice']['Service']['AIGetActiveProvider']();
|
|
}
|
|
|
|
export function AIGetBuiltinPrompts() {
|
|
return window['go']['aiservice']['Service']['AIGetBuiltinPrompts']();
|
|
}
|
|
|
|
export function AIGetContextLevel() {
|
|
return window['go']['aiservice']['Service']['AIGetContextLevel']();
|
|
}
|
|
|
|
export function AIGetProviders() {
|
|
return window['go']['aiservice']['Service']['AIGetProviders']();
|
|
}
|
|
|
|
export function AIGetSafetyLevel() {
|
|
return window['go']['aiservice']['Service']['AIGetSafetyLevel']();
|
|
}
|
|
|
|
export function AIGetSessions() {
|
|
return window['go']['aiservice']['Service']['AIGetSessions']();
|
|
}
|
|
|
|
export function AIListModels() {
|
|
return window['go']['aiservice']['Service']['AIListModels']();
|
|
}
|
|
|
|
export function AILoadSession(arg1) {
|
|
return window['go']['aiservice']['Service']['AILoadSession'](arg1);
|
|
}
|
|
|
|
export function AISaveProvider(arg1) {
|
|
return window['go']['aiservice']['Service']['AISaveProvider'](arg1);
|
|
}
|
|
|
|
export function AISaveSession(arg1, arg2, arg3, arg4) {
|
|
return window['go']['aiservice']['Service']['AISaveSession'](arg1, arg2, arg3, arg4);
|
|
}
|
|
|
|
export function AISetActiveProvider(arg1) {
|
|
return window['go']['aiservice']['Service']['AISetActiveProvider'](arg1);
|
|
}
|
|
|
|
export function AISetContextLevel(arg1) {
|
|
return window['go']['aiservice']['Service']['AISetContextLevel'](arg1);
|
|
}
|
|
|
|
export function AISetSafetyLevel(arg1) {
|
|
return window['go']['aiservice']['Service']['AISetSafetyLevel'](arg1);
|
|
}
|
|
|
|
export function AITestProvider(arg1) {
|
|
return window['go']['aiservice']['Service']['AITestProvider'](arg1);
|
|
}
|